Comparison of Troyan and Kınık ceramic culture in the context of intercultural interaction

Abstract (EN)

There are many different definitions of Culture. International interactions ensure the blending of different cultures with each other and the formation of intercultural interaction. War, migration and trade, which enable cultural interactions, ensure that the traditions, beliefs, artisan and artistic works of the societies interact with each other. It is known that Troyan, a mountain town of Bulgaria, was a stop on the migration route in ancient times and those who fled from wars took refuge here. Due to its geographical location, Troyan has rich opportunities in terms of ceramic raw material reserves. For this reason, pottery is preferred in ceramic production and is transmitted from generation to generation. It is known that potters introduced this art to the whole world with their original pouring decors on the surfaces of the works. They ensured that the décor of the Turkish communities living in Bulgaria to pour those who fled the war and migrated to Anatolia was carried to the Kınık region and this technique was recognized as a decoration feature of Kınık. In the first part of this study, the concept of culture, definitions of intercultural interaction, causes and ceramic art that develops and progresses thanks to interactions are examined. In the second part of the thesis, the history, art and ceramics of Bulgaria and the pouring decorations of the city of Troyan, which is known to the whole world, the development and progress of this special art were examined. In the third part, the development of Kınık pottery, the fact that Şakir ağa, who emigrated from Bulgaria, brought the décor of pouring to our country and the use of this décor technique from past to present were examined. In the fourth part, the Troyan and Kınık ceramic culture is evaluated by comparison. In the last and fifth part of the thesis, personal practices are included. Keywords: Bulgaria, Ceramic Culture, Culture, Kınık Slipware Decor, Troyan Slipware Decor
